We came to IKAT to celebrate our friend's birthday. We hadn't ordered a banquet, just some chicken samsa (it was hot and fresh), lamb shashlik (incredibly tasty and tender, without the unpleasant smell of old lamb that sometimes happens), and a Greek salad. However, our kind waiter Alex overheard that we were toasting to the birthday girl and brought her a portion of "Napoleon" cake from the establishment. She was thrilled to find out that "Napoleon" is her favorite cake. But we didn't stop there and also odered some baklava. I really appreciated that the dishes were seasoned just right. Often, in Austrian restaurants, everything is too salty for my taste. And the dessert flavors didn't overpower the sweetness of sugar. We immensely enjoyed the food, the atmosphere, and the attentive service. The service was friendly yet unintrusive. Highly recommended.

The food was also not as I expected. Not surprising as we had no idea what kind of food Uzbekistan has.

We started with soup. My wife had Creamy Pumpkin Soup and I had Chorba soup with lamb. They came with fresh, hot bread.

We split two dishes for the main course: Plov (beef, rice and veggies) and Manti (like big beef and lamb pierogis).

All was very good. Price was reasonable. With the above, two glasses of wine and a beer, the total was €68.

They have English menus with pictures which made ordering easy. Waiters spoke English, too.
